WebFeb 20, 2024 · Color contrast ratio is determined by comparing the luminance of the text and background color values. In order to meet current Web Content Accessibility Guidelines (WCAG), a ratio of 4.5:1 is required for text content and 3:1 for larger text such as headings. Large text is defined as 18.66px and bold or larger, or 24px or larger. WebMar 6, 2024 · Modern browsers support using SVG within CSS styles to apply graphical effects to HTML content.
